Driver in stolen car smashes into armed police van during 100mph chase
A driver, Marlon Henriques, crashed a stolen car into an armed police van during a 100mph chase through country roads in Wiltshire.
The 12-minute pursuit began when officers tried to stop Henriques for speeding, during which he displayed extremely reckless driving, including running red lights.
Henriques's dangerous driving resulted in him crashing into another van, causing it to overturn, before then colliding with a police firearms vehicle.
The 30-year-old was jailed for 22 months and disqualified from driving for four years and 11 months after admitting to multiple offences, including dangerous driving and taking a vehicle without consent.
